Former Jackass star Bam Margera has had a rough go of it lately.
In January, Margera entered rehab for the third time. Then he left after just 10 days.
In March, Margera entered a behavorial facility after videos surfaced of him publicly going off on his tour manager and his wife Nicole.

This past weekend, he was kicked off a Southwest flight after berating an airport police officer.
Then Margera posted a disturbing series of Instagram videos saying, among other things, that he “disowned his mom” and “can’t stand” his wife, who he said might be causing him to lose his mind.
Margera also said he “almost died the other day” and asked Dr. Phil for help, which was accepted.
According to TMZ, after his 3-hour meeting with Dr. Phil on Monday, Margera is now headed back to rehab for what is expected to be a 60 to 90 day stay.
Sources with direct knowledge of the conversation tell us it was a very emotional sit down, with Bam tearing up several times. We’re told things came to a “boiling point” when Bam’s wife, Nikki, joined Dr. Phil. Bam confronted Nikki about what he considers her “extreme stubbornness” … according to our sources.
We’re told Bam’s mother also participated in the session — and she and Nikki asked Phil for help identifying what kind of substances Bam was abusing.
Margera’s mom April spoke with TMZ and told them that Bam’s loved ones are at the “end of our rope.”
TMZ also reported that Dr. Phil’s session with Margera will air next month when the new season of his show premieres, because of course it will.
